Laura Myers, Partner and Head of DCDownhill all the way? What data on 100,000 pensioners tells us about post-retirement spending journeys
New laws will soon require pension providers to design post-retirement journeys for their savers. But what should these look like? Former Pensions Minister, Sir Steve Webb will present new research based on the incomes and spending patterns of over 100,000 pensioners collected over the last fifty years to shed new light on this topical and important issue.
